Folding the Drill
Pinch Point and Crushing Hazard. To prevent serious injury or
death:
Always use transport locks when drill is folded.
Fold only if hydraulics are bled free of air and fully
charged with hydraulic oil.
Stay away from frame sections when they are being raised
or lowered.
Keep away and keep others away when folding or
unfolding drill.
Fold the drill on level ground with the tractor in neutral. If
your drill has markers, be certain they are folded and
their control switches are off before folding.
Refer to Figure 6
1. Raise drill with lift cylinders until cylinders are fully
extended.
2. Install lock channels over extended wheel-cylinder
rods on center section.
Refer to Figure 7
3. Move handle on fold latch ahead into road position.
4. Active hydraulics and slowly fold drill until wings
trigger the spring-loaded fold latch and are secure in
the latch.
Rephasing Lift System
Over a period of normal use the cylinders may get out of
phase. This will cause some drill sections to run higher
than others. To rephase cylinders:
1. Raise the implement completely and hold the
hydraulic remote lever on for several seconds until
all cylinders are fully extended. Do this every time
you raise drill out of ground.
2. When all cylinders are fully extended, momentarily
reverse hydraulic remote lever to retract system 1/2
inch to maintain levelness.
